Apple rejected my app update and now my keyword rankings reset to zero - how to maintain ASO during review delays?
When Apple rejects an app update, rankings reset because the App Store algorithm interprets metadata changes as potential manipulation. To maintain ASO during review delays, focus on preserving existing rankings through compliant keyword strategies and diversifying traffic sources while resolving rejection issues.
# How to Maintain ASO Rankings After App Update Rejections
App Store rejections trigger immediate ranking resets because Apple's algorithm assumes abrupt metadata changes indicate spam behavior. Rejected updates typically cause 30-50% ranking drops within 72 hours, with full recovery taking 2-4 weeks even after approval. Here's how to minimize damage and maintain your ASO performance during these challenging periods.
Understanding Why Rankings Reset
Apple's algorithm treats rejected updates as red flags for several reasons:
Metadata Instability Signals: When you submit an update with keyword changes and it gets rejected, the algorithm interprets this as potential manipulation attempts. The system assumes you're trying to game rankings through rapid keyword switching.
Quality Score Impact: Rejections negatively affect your app's overall quality score within Apple's ecosystem. This internal metric influences how your app appears in search results and recommendations.
Review Velocity Penalties: Apps with rejection histories face longer review times and stricter scrutiny on future submissions, creating a compounding effect on ranking stability.
Immediate Damage Control Strategies
When facing a rejection, quick action can prevent further ranking deterioration:
Preserve Your Current Position
Never submit additional updates while one is under review. Multiple pending submissions can trigger Apple's spam detection systems, leading to account-level penalties that affect all your apps.
Analyze the Rejection Notice Thoroughly
Apple provides specific guideline violation codes. Common ASO-related rejections include:
- Guideline 2.3.1 for misleading metadata
- Guideline 4.3 for spam or duplicate functionality
- Guideline 5.2.1 for inappropriate content in descriptions
Understanding the exact violation helps you craft a compliant resubmission strategy.
Document Everything
Keep detailed records of all metadata changes, rejection reasons, and communication with Apple. This documentation becomes crucial for appeals and future submissions.

Maintaining Rankings During Extended Reviews
Apple's review delays vary significantly, from 48 hours for simple updates to 14+ days for apps in regulated categories. During these waiting periods:
Technical Preservation Tactics
Maintain Organic Traffic Flow: Keep existing marketing campaigns active, directing users to your live App Store page. Consistent download velocity signals to Apple that your app remains relevant and valuable.
Leverage Secondary Metadata Fields: While your main description is under review, you can still optimize supporting elements:
- App preview videos can reinforce keyword relevance
- Screenshot captions provide additional context
- Developer name and company information should remain consistent
Monitor Competitor Movements: Track how competitors are positioning themselves during your downtime. This intelligence helps you identify keyword opportunities for your eventual relaunch.
Algorithm-Friendly Adjustments
Our ASO specialists recommend these compliant optimization techniques:
Semantic Keyword Variants: Instead of completely changing keywords, use related terms that maintain topical consistency. For example, "mobile banking" can become "phone finance manager" without triggering spam detection.
Gradual Implementation Strategy: Never change more than 30% of your keywords in a single update. This threshold helps maintain algorithmic trust while allowing for meaningful optimization.
Entity Consistency Maintenance: Ensure all your app assets communicate the same core functionality. Mixed signals confuse Apple's categorization systems and can extend review times.
Post-Rejection Recovery Protocol
Once Apple approves your resubmission, rankings don't automatically return to previous levels. Recovery requires strategic patience:
Staged Metadata Updates
Implement changes in three phases over 21 days:
- Week 1: Core functionality keywords only
- Week 2: Secondary feature terms
- Week 3: Competitive positioning keywords
This gradual approach rebuilds algorithmic trust while monitoring performance at each stage.
Conversion Rate Optimization Focus
Improve your install-to-view ratio through:
- Compelling screenshot sequences that clearly demonstrate value
- Concise, benefit-focused descriptions
- Strategic use of social proof in reviews and ratings
Higher conversion rates signal quality to Apple's algorithm, accelerating ranking recovery.
Review Velocity Monitoring
Track how quickly new ratings and reviews appear after reinstatement. Healthy apps typically see 1-3 new reviews per 100 downloads. Significant deviations indicate ongoing algorithmic penalties.

Building Long-Term ASO Resilience
Sustainable ASO requires proactive compliance and diversification strategies:
Quarterly Compliance Audits
Regular metadata reviews help identify potential violations before submission:
- Keyword density analysis to avoid over-optimization
- Competitor comparison to ensure differentiation
- Guideline compliance verification across all app elements
